your interest in applying to become a Rise Up Leader in Kenya!
Eligible
candidates must meet the following selection criteria:
·
Civil Society leaders of
minimum 18 years of age at the time of the training in July 2025.
·
Currently working in Nairobi,
Kiambu, Kajiado or Machakos Counties.
·
Has a personal interest and
current commitment to promoting gender equity broadly in the three priority
areas of health, education, and economic opportunity for women, girls, and
gender-nonconforming people.
·
Represents or works closely
with marginalized groups from socially or economically marginalized
communities, women and girls with disabilities, ethnic and/or religious
minorities, and other historically disadvantaged populations.
·
Ability to participate in an
in-person training from July 14-19, 2025, with some virtual sessions
pre-and-post training. Please note that Rise Up will cover all costs related to
program participation, including transportation, accommodation, food, and materials.
·
Currently works at a non-profit
organization, civil society organization, media organization, or government
organization at a level of coordination or management and has some level of
decision-making power.
·
Has the support of your
organization’s leadership to participate in Rise Up’s Leadership and Advocacy
Accelerator training.
·
To be eligible for a grant,
Rise Up requires organizations to be legally registered in-country and set up
to receive international funds. Entities that are not registered can be
sponsored by another financial entity or fiscal sponsor. Note: Government organizations
are not eligible to receive grants through this program.
·
Proficient in oral and written
English.
